Unity Bank Plc has reaffirmed its dedication to promoting electronic payments and enhancing financial inclusion through a new partnership with AfriGo, a local card scheme provider. The collaboration aims to increase the use of AfriGo cards among the bank’s retail customers. The announcement was made during a high-level strategic meeting at Unity Bank’s headquarters in Lagos on Friday, attended by AfriGo’s executive team.

The Independent National Electoral Commission, on Wednesday, released the final list of candidates for the 2025 Anambra State governorship election. The electoral body also announced June 11 as the official commencement date for election campaigns, which must end at midnight on Thursday, November 6, 2025.

Mbaishii Autonomous community in Ngor/Okpala Local Government Area of Imo State has cried out over what they described as an “economic genocide” and a “brutal land grab” allegedly orchestrated by the Imo State Government in collaboration with Evangelist Ebuka Obi’s Zion Ministry. They raised the alarm during a world press conference held on Wednesday at the Nigeria Union of Journalists (NUJ) Secretariat in Abuja.
